%% WARNING: DO NOT EDIT, AUTO-GENERATED CODE! %% See https://github.com/aws-beam/aws-codegen for more details. %% @doc Elastic Load Balancing %% %% A load balancer distributes incoming traffic across targets, such as your %% EC2 instances. %% %% This enables you to increase the availability of your application. The %% load balancer also %% monitors the health of its registered targets and ensures that it routes %% traffic only to %% healthy targets. You configure your load balancer to accept incoming %% traffic by specifying one %% or more listeners, which are configured with a protocol and port number %% for connections from %% clients to the load balancer. You configure a target group with a protocol %% and port number for %% connections from the load balancer to the targets, and with health check %% settings to be used %% when checking the health status of the targets. %% %% Elastic Load Balancing supports the following types of load balancers: %% Application Load %% Balancers, Network Load Balancers, Gateway Load Balancers, and Classic %% Load Balancers. This %% reference covers the following load balancer types: %% %% Application Load Balancer - Operates at the application layer (layer 7) %% and supports %% HTTP and HTTPS. %% %% Network Load Balancer - Operates at the transport layer (layer 4) and %% supports TCP, %% TLS, UDP, and QUIC. %% %% Gateway Load Balancer - Operates at the network layer (layer 3). %% %% For more information, see the Elastic Load Balancing User %% Guide: https://docs.aws.amazon.com/elasticloadbalancing/latest/userguide/. %% %% All Elastic Load Balancing operations are idempotent, which means that %% they complete at %% most one time.
